Issa Tchiroma Bakary, presidential candidate for the 2025 election and leader of the Front for the National Salvation of Cameroon (FSNC), is now holding a campaign meeting in Édéa. This visit follows recent high-profile rallies in Douala and other cities, signaling a push to expand his influence across the country.
